Hereford Poultry Auctions 2010

New postby Rhode Runner on February 12th, 2010, 3:31 pm

Summer RARE BREED SALE SATURDAY 26TH June AT 10.30am
CLOSING DATE FOR ENTRIES MONDAY 14TH June
Autumn Rare Breed Sale 9thOctober 2010

Rare Breed Entry Form: http://www.sunderlandsfinearts.co.uk/do ... ebreed.pdf

Weekly sales every Wednesday from February 3rd starting at 10 a.m.
Poultry Market doors open at 7am all poultry must be booked in by 9.30am

Where:
The Cattle Market
Newmarket Street
Hereford
HR4 9HX
